How to fill out Early Intervention Credential Extension Request Form

01
Obtain the Early Intervention Credential Extension Request Form from the relevant authority or website.
02
Fill in your personal information, including your name, address, and contact details.
03
Provide your current Early Intervention Credential details, including the credential number and expiration date.
04
Indicate the reason for the extension request, ensuring to provide adequate justification.
05
Attach any required supporting documents, such as proof of ongoing training or professional development.
06
Review the completed form for accuracy and completeness.
07
Submit the form via the specified method (online, by mail, etc.) before the deadline.

The Early Intervention Credential Extension Request Form is a document used by professionals in the early intervention field to request an extension of their credential status, allowing them to continue providing services to infants and toddlers with developmental delays.
Individuals who hold an early intervention credential and are seeking to extend their credential status must file the Early Intervention Credential Extension Request Form.
To fill out the Early Intervention Credential Extension Request Form, applicants must provide their personal and credential information, including their name, credential number, and the reason for the extension request, and submit any required supporting documentation.
The purpose of the Early Intervention Credential Extension Request Form is to formally request an extension of an individual's credential, ensuring that they remain qualified to provide necessary early intervention services.
The information that must be reported includes the applicant's full name, credential number, contact information, the reason for the extension request, and any relevant supporting materials such as continuing education credits or documentation of professional development.
